Activation of Cl− Channels by Human Chorionic Gonadotropin in Luteinized Granulosa Cells of the Human Ovary Modulates Progesterone Biosynthesis

Abstract: Chloride permeability pathways and progesterone (P4) secretion elicited by human chorionic gonadotropin (hCG) in human granulosa cells were studied by electrophysiological techniques and single-cell volume, membrane potential and Ca2+i measurements. Reduction in extracellular Cl(-) and equimolar substitution by the membrane-impermeant anions glutamate or gluconate significantly increased hCG-stimulated P4 accumulation.
